SYNCHRONIZATION METHODS AND SYSTEMS
First Claim
1. A machine implemented method performed at a device comprising:
- receiving a request to synchronize a data class;
determining a version number of a data class handler for the data class;
determining a synchronization mode for the data class; and
synchronizing the data class based on the synchronization mode.
0 Assignments
0 Petitions
Accused Products
Abstract
Connection architectures, methods, systems and computer readable media are described. In one exemplary embodiment, a computer readable medium comprises a first software component which is configured to interface, through first software based messages, with synchronization software components during a structured data synchronization process between a host and a device and which is configured to interface, through second software based messages, with a plurality of different stream handlers for a corresponding plurality of physical interfaces. Systems, methods, architectures and other computer readable media are also described.
83 Citations
55 Claims
-
1. A machine implemented method performed at a device comprising:
-
receiving a request to synchronize a data class; determining a version number of a data class handler for the data class; determining a synchronization mode for the data class; and synchronizing the data class based on the synchronization mode.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. A machine implemented method performed at a host comprising:
-
sending a request to synchronize a data class; obtaining a version number of a data source of the data class; determining a synchronization mode for the data class; and synchronizing the data class based on the synchronization mode. - View Dependent Claims (12, 13, 14, 15, 16, 17, 18, 19, 20)
-
-
21. A computer readable medium storing executable program instructions which when executed cause a data processing system to perform operations comprising:
-
receiving a request to synchronize a data class; determining a version number of a data class handler for the data class; determining a synchronization mode for the data class; and synchronizing the data class based on the synchronization mode. - View Dependent Claims (22, 23, 24, 25, 26, 27, 28, 29, 30)
-
-
31. A computer readable medium storing executable program instructions which when executed cause a data processing system to perform operations comprising:
-
sending a request to synchronize a data class; obtaining a version number of a data source of the data class; determining a synchronization mode for the data class; and synchronizing the data class based on the synchronization mode. - View Dependent Claims (32, 33, 34, 35, 36, 37, 38, 39, 40)
-
-
41. A data processing system comprising:
-
means for receiving a request to synchronize a data class; means for determining a version number of a data class handler for the data class; means for determining a synchronization mode for the data class; and means for synchronizing the data class based on the synchronization mode. - View Dependent Claims (42, 43, 44, 45, 46, 47)
-
-
48. A data processing system comprising:
-
means for sending a request to synchronize a data class; means for obtaining a version number of a data source of the data class; means for determining a synchronization mode for the data class; and means for synchronizing the data class based on the synchronization mode. - View Dependent Claims (49, 50, 51, 52, 53, 54, 55)
-
Specification